Material identification system

DWPI Title: Method for identifying material in water bottle using object scanning system, involves identifying material in object using estimated attenuations and known attenuation information for identifying material in object by computer system
Abstract: A method and apparatus for identifying a material in an object. An image of the object generated from energy passing through the object is obtained by a computer system. The computer system estimates attenuations for pixels in a sensor system from the image of the object to form estimated attenuations. The estimated attenuations represent a loss of the energy that occurs from the energy passing through the object. The computer system also identifies the material in the object using the estimated attenuations and known attenuation information for identifying the material in the object.
Use: Method for identifying a material in an object i.e. water bottle, using an object scanning system.
Advantage: The method enables quickly and accurately identifying the material in the object than with a currently available X-ray scanning system.
Novelty: The method involves obtaining an image of an object (106) generated from energy passing through the object by a computer system. Attenuations for pixels in a sensor system are estimated from the image of the object to form estimated attenuations by the computer system, where the estimated attenuations represent loss of the energy that occurs from the energy passing through the object. Material (104) in the object is identified using the estimated attenuations and known attenuation information for identifying the material in the object by the computer system.
